We're transforming the trillion-dollar world of in-person sales by capturing and analyzing a never-before-digitized dataset: face-to-face conversations. While the tech world obsesses over digital interactions, most of our economy still runs on millions of in-person sales and service conversations happening daily across the U.S. Unlike Zoom calls, these conversations weren't historically recorded – leaving petabytes of rich data untapped. Until now.
Companies in hundreds of industries rely on frontline salesforces working in-person, yet they've operated with zero visibility into these critical customer interactions. Meanwhile, sales productivity follows a stark Pareto distribution – the vast majority of commissions accumulate to a small percentage of top performers, leaving millions of salespeople struggling to achieve financial freedom.
With Siro, we're democratizing sales excellence. Our customers see their reps closing up to 40% more deals, all while gaining unprecedented insights from field conversations.
We've built an intelligence platform that captures, processes, and derives actionable insights from in-person sales and service conversations. Our customers span diverse industries – home improvement, home services (HVAC, plumbing), retail, B2B distribution, insurance, hospitality, and more.
With over $75M in backing from world-class investors, we're on a mission to make field sales the most accessible path to financial freedom.
Our product is already making waves - 4.8 stars on the App Store (700+ ratings), 5.0 stars on G2 (25 reviews), and partnerships with industry leaders like ServiceTitan (NASDAQ: TTAN).

In case you’re curious, we use the following technologies (and more), but proficiency in any specific technology is not required.
Frontend: React Native, Svelte, TypeScript
Mobile: Swift, Kotlin
Backend: Node.js, Typescript, serverless functions
Cloud: Google Cloud Platform (GCP)
Other tools: Git, Datadog, Figma
